Hendrickson, Klinglesmith receive CCA Volunteer of the Year awards
MEEKER | The 2023 Colorado Cattlemen’s Association celebrated its 156th annual convention in Steamboat Springs this month. Among multiple awards presented, Meeker’s Callie Hendrickson and Lenny Klinglesmith were recipients of Volunteer of the Year awards.

Meeker nets $750K+ from GOCO
MEEKER | The Great Outdoors Colorado (GOCO) board has awarded $750,000 to the Town of Meeker for new community access points on the White River. In addition, a $45,000 grant through Keep It Colorado to Colorado Cattlemen’s Agricultural Land Trust (CCALT) will help conserve Theos Family Ranches east of Meeker.[Read More…]

MHS greenhouse to be finished by August
MEEKER | Construction of the greenhouse at Meeker High School is expected to be complete by August, according to Principal Amy Chinn, in time for the 2023-24 school year.
